I feel that this movie is one of the best of releases of 2021 for home video. In most action movies, the focus is on action and not characters. The movie has put an emphasis on the characters and I like that. Milla Jovovich leads her squad on a mission to find another squad of soldiers who have turned up missing. I feel that her character is strong but still feminine and she portrays a good leader for the men in her unit. I also enjoyed the way the movie shows the camaraderie between the member of the unit. The movie doesn't give a whole of background for each member of her squad, but you do feel a bit saddened when a character loses their life.
The computer effects are top notch. I was extremely impressed with some of the realism that they presented in the movie. The best part of the movie is the sound. If you don't have DTS:X/Dolby Atmos setup you are missing out. The movie is loud, but it is the little effects that make this movie stand out. There is this scene where Milla Jovovich and another character called the Hunter who rescues her and they are held up in his cave like structure. There are giant spiders trying to get in and the movie lets you see them. The movie then pans to Milla and the hunter inside his cave, but you still hear the spiders trying to get in from the top of his cave. They are picking at the rock and all that sound is coming from your Atmos speakers. It is one of the coolest uses of object based sound placement I have heard. There are other scenes similar to this but this is my favorite. I will say it again, if you don't have an DTS:X/Atmos setup your missing out with the amount of sound movie places in the height speakers. A lot of movies will claim Atmos and have very little use for the height speakers. This movie uses them a lot.
I totally enjoyed this movie and have watched it about 10 times and never get tired. I am still listening for things that I might have missed in the movie soundtrack.
If you have the appropriate system this is a movie to demo to friends and family. Another huge note: This movie is family friendly. There are some scary scenes but it contains very little profanity and no nudity. I know that is a downer for some people. lol.

There is only one proper way for watching a Paul W.S. Anderson movie, and that is to set all expectations aside and simply enjoy the mindless, popcorn silliness. Based on the video game series of the same name, Monster Hunter not only demonstrates he has made a career at B-quality escapism, but that he is also decently good at churning out surprisingly entertaining shlock, especially when framing action vehicles for Milla Jovovich. The entertainingly bonkers adaptation teleports to Ultra HD equipped with a monstrously gorgeous 4K HDR10 presentation and thunderously awesome Dolby Atmos soundtrack, offering fans and the curious a notable upgrade over its Blu-ray counterpart. Porting over the same puny set of supplements, the UHD package is nonetheless recommended.

First off, I strongly recommend against watching any movie based off a videogame/anime/book if you are expecting the story you already know. Why watch something when you already know everything that's going to happen? They have to change things up to keep it interesting!
That said, I thoroughly enjoyed the movie. Sure, there was some things they messed up...like the Rathalos' (It's not a spoiler...it's right there on the box!) weakness and such. But I liked the attention to detail in other things like them using traps and other monsters poison against bigger threats. Plus, it was very cool to see how modern military would stand against a monster threat!
The only gripe I would have would be them casting Ron Perlman as the Admiral. They could've got some less known actor and saved money with the snore inducing performance he gave. He had very few speaking lines and his action bits were the least impressive out of the entire movie with the coolest things he does being entirely special effects.
Aside from that poor casting choice, I think Milla Jovovich followed through with her usual action movie performances, and Tony Jaa is still a thrill to watch thanks to his actual background with Muay Thai fighting.
In closing, I'm rating this movie 5/5 because I enjoyed it, not because it's perfect. Don't go in expecting to see the game you likely already know, this story is about a modern soldier being sent into a small portion of that world, not exploring the entire world itself.
